Nordic Capital sells its remaining shares in Nordnet after a successful transformation

MAY 27 2021

Nordic Capital1 has sold its remaining shares in Nordnet, a leading pan-Nordic digital savings and investments platform. Under Nordic Capital’s ownership, and in close partnership with the founding Öhman Group, Nordnet underwent significant transformative change and now offers a  best-in-class customer experience in the digital savings industry with sustainable growth potential.

In November 2020, Nordnet was successfully listed on Nasdaq Stockholm at an equity value of approximately SEK 24 bn. The successful listing and subsequent strong share price performance reflect the strength of Nordnet’s business and its fast growth; the result of significant improvements implemented during Nordic Capital’s ownership. On 26 May 2021, Nordic Capital initiated an accelerated book building process to sell its remaining 9.2% shareholding to a group of long-term institutional investors. Following this sale, Nordic Capital no longer owns any shares in Nordnet, while the founding Öhman Group remains the largest shareholder. The equity value of Nordnet on 26 May 2021 was SEK 38 bn.

In 2017, Nordnet was taken private by Nordic Capital and the Öhman Group, who shared the ambition to create a best-in-class customer experience in the digital savings industry. As a result of significant platform investments, enhanced user experiences and product innovation, Nordnet considerably increased its customer activity and engagement, expanded its share of the Nordic market and accelerated its growth trajectory. In addition, Nordnet advanced its sustainability agenda to further promote sustainable savings and democratise savings and investments in society. Nordnet also invested in a strengthened organisation, with its experienced management team focused on scaling the platform and delivering strong profitable growth.

In the first quarter of 2021, Nordnet had a record-breaking inflow of new savers with 39% annual customer growth and all-time high net savings capital of SEK 648 billion. Nordnet more than doubled the customer base and  nearly tripled net savings capital during Nordic Capital’s ownership.

About Nordic Capital

Nordic Capital is a leading private equity investor with a resolute commitment to creating stronger, sustainable businesses through operational improvement and transformative growth. Nordic Capital focuses on selected regions and sectors where it has deep experience and a long history. Focus sectors are Healthcare, Technology & Payments, Financial Services, and selectively, Industrial & Business Services. Key regions are Europe and globally for Healthcare and Technology & Payments investments. Since inception in 1989, Nordic Capital has invested more than EUR 17 billion in close to 120 investments. The most recent fund is Nordic Capital Fund X with EUR 6.1 billion in committed capital, principally provided by international institutional investors such as pension funds. Nordic Capital Advisors have local offices in Sweden, Denmark, Finland, Norway, Germany, the UK and the US. For further information about Nordic Capital, please visit www.nordiccapital.com
